Looking at the various drawings of Daf's new XF, CF and LF range, CM is struck by how close they are to the final product as witnessed by this design treatment and photo of the new XF. It suggests to us that whatever the vehicle, or its job, the Dutch truck maker's design team have a highly developed understanding of what's needed to satisfy the multiple demands from Daf's top management, production engineers, product marketeers and dealers, as well as customers and drivers.
